Backend Developer

Java

Backend Developer

Java
Full-time
B2B
Mid
Hybrid

Job description

Jako firma rekrutacyjna jesteśmy świadomi, że każdy solidny biznes napędzają ludzie z odpowiednio dopasowanymi kompetencjami. Nasz styl zarządzania i partnerskie podejście pozwalają nam na elastyczne dostosowanie się do Twoich potrzeb i zapewniają pełne wsparcie podczas współpracy. W związku z ciągłym rozwojem i dużą liczbą projektów rekrutacyjnych, jakie prowadzimy dla naszych Partnerów, szukamy osoby na stanowisko:

Backend Developer

Praca hybrydowa - 2x w tygodniu praca z biura

Zakres obowiązków:

  • Projektowanie i implementacja usług backendowych

  • Integracja z bazami danych i systemami zewnętrznymi

  • Tworzenie i utrzymywanie dokumentacji technicznej (w tym z użyciem Markdown)

  • Udział w analizach i projektowaniu rozwiązań (współpraca z analitykami i architektami)

  • Modelowanie i implementacja procesów BPMN/DMN (Camunda/Kogito)

  • Tworzenie testów jednostkowych i integracyjnych

  • Migracje danych

  • Współpraca z zespołem DevOps

  • Dbanie o bezpieczeństwo i jakość kodu, udział w code review

  • Rozwiązywanie zgłoszeń użytkowników systemów (użycie ITSM Remedy, Jira): analiza zgłoszeń, analiza logów, przygotowywanie poprawek na poziomie kodu i DB

 

Wymagania:

  • Bardzo dobra znajomość Java (JVM, współbieżność, optymalizacja, Clean Code)

  • Doświadczenie w Spring Boot (mikroserwisy, Spring Security, Spring Data, integracje)

  • Znajomość Quarkus (native build, konfiguracja rozszerzeń)

  • Praktyczna znajomość Docker oraz docker-compose

  • Doświadczenie w CI/CD GitLab (pipeline'y, automatyzacja buildów, testów i deploymentów)

  • Znajomość baz danych: PostgreSQL, MySQL, MongoDB, Oracle

  • Doświadczenie w testach jednostkowych (JUnit, Mockito)

  • Umiejętność projektowania i zabezpieczania REST API oraz tworzenia dokumentacji OpenAPI

  • Znajomość BPMS (Camunda, Kogito), BPMN/DMN oraz integracji z mikroserwisami

  • Znajomość zagadnień bezpieczeństwa aplikacji i kontroli dostępu (OAuth2, OpenID, Keycloak)

  • Umiejętność tworzenia dokumentacji technicznej w Markdown

  • Wykorzystanie narzędzi AI w procesie developmentu (generowanie kodu, testów, analiza błędów, refaktoryzacja)

 

Oferujemy:

  • Prywatną opiekę medyczną

  • Dofinansowanie karty sportowej

  • Szkolenia językowe

  • Stałe wsparcie konsultanta

  • Program rekomendacji pracowników

Tech stack

    Polish

    B2

    Java

    advanced

    JVM

    advanced

    Clean Code

    advanced

    Spring Boot

    advanced

    Quarkus

    advanced

    Docker

    advanced

    CI/CD

    advanced

    PostgreSQL

    advanced

    MySQL

    advanced

    JUnit

    advanced

Office location

About the company

DCG

DCG to przestrzeń, w której spotykają się potrzeby biznesu i ambicje ludzi. Znamy wartość dobrze dopasowanej współpracy, dlatego pomagamy kandydatom znaleźć środowisko, w którym będą mogli rozwinąć skrzydła, a firmom - z...
Company profile

Backend Developer

Summary of the offer

Backend Developer

--, Wrocław
DCG
By applying, I consent to the processing of my personal data for the purpose of conducting the recruitment process. Informujemy, że administratorem danych jest DCG Sp. z o.o., ul. Towarowa 28, 00-839 Warszawa (dalej jako "administrator"). Masz prawo ... MoreThis site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.